Isolated Points on $X_1(\ell^n)$ with rational $j$-invariant}

Abstract

Let \ell be a prime and let n1n\geq 1. In this note we show that if there is a non-cuspidal, non-CM isolated point xx with a rational jj-invariant on the modular curve X1(n)X_1(\ell^n), then =37\ell=37 and the jj-invariant of xx is either 71137\cdot11^3 or 7.137320833-7.137^3\cdot2083^3. The reverse implication holds for the first j-invariant but it is currently unknown whether or not it holds for the second.
